Podcast Description

The podcast where you can really get to know a classic book without actually reading it!
Moby Dick... Frankenstein... Dracula... you KNOW what these books are about... but have you actually read them? Well maybe you should. Or, you can just listen to us! Join Taylor and Kaleena for a bit to feel like you have read a classic without actually reading it! We'll tell the whole story, chapter-by-chapter, and have a damn good time doing it.

Content Themes

Focuses on classic literature with episodes dedicated to books such as Frankenstein, 20,000 Leagues Under the Sea, and The Hound of the Baskervilles, exploring themes of guilt, adventure, and mystery through engaging discussions and humorous commentary, including memorable moments like the trials of Victor Frankenstein and adventures under the sea.
